My wife and I have dined at Amici several times and have been impressed with the food and service each time we visit. On our last visit we decided to let the manager recommed some of his favorite wines. We were very pleased with his wine suggestion. Tommasi Rippacolo at $9 per glass was easily comparable to wines that I have had that were $70 a bottle. We then decided to try the Antipasta appetizer. We choose three items from the beautiful display. Each item was fresh and flavorful, we were not dissappointed. I ordered the Medallions of Beef which was cooked to perfection. The flavorful sauce enhanced rather than overpowered the flavor of the beef. My wife decided to try the Snapper Agrume and she said that it was wonderful. Finally, we decided to share a dessert. We choose the Strawberry Ricotta Cake. It was the perfect ending to an outstanding meal. Amici is a welcomed addition to Sugar Land!! There is no reason to drive into town for a superb dining experience. The food, service and prices will keep us coming back for more.
